Ingredients:

  • 4 salmon fillets
  • 1 cup diced mango
  • 1/2 cup diced red onion
  • 1/2 cup diced red bell pepper
  • 1 jalapeño, minced
  • 1/4 cup chopped cilantro
  • Juice of 1 lime
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Olive oil for grilling

Method:

Step 1: Preheat the Grill

Begin by preheating your grill to medium-high heat. This will ensure that the salmon gets that delicious char while keeping the inside tender and juicy.

Step 2: Create the Salsa

In a mixing bowl, combine the diced mango, red onion, red bell pepper, minced jalapeño, chopped cilantro, and lime juice. Season with salt and pepper to taste. The vibrant colors of this salsa will brighten up any plate!

Step 3: Prep the Salmon

While the salsa is coming together, brush each salmon fillet with olive oil. This not only adds flavor but also helps the salmon achieve a beautiful, golden sear on the grill. Season with salt and pepper to your liking—don’t be shy!

Step 4: Grill the Salmon

Carefully place the salmon fillets on the hot grill. Grill for about 4-5 minutes on each side or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ork. The grill marks will be your reward for a job well done!

Step 5: Serve the Dish

Once the salmon is perfectly grilled, it’s time to serve! Plate the salmon and generously top it with the vibrant mango salsa. Enjoy the beautiful colors and the beautiful flavor combination that unfolds with each bite.

Storage & Leftovers Guide

If you have leftover salmon, store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. The mango salsa is best enjoyed fresh but can last in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at the salmon gently in the microwave or on the stovetop for the best results.

Kitchen Wisdom & Success Tips

  • To make the salsa ahead of time, prepare it a few hours before serving.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ully!
  • If you prefer a milder salsa, remove the seeds from the jalapeño before mincing.
  • Always ensure your grill is adequately preheated to prevent sticking and to achieve the perfect char.

Flavor Variations & Adaptations

Feel free to get creative! You can substitute the mango with diced pineapple for a different fruit-forward flavor. Use a different type of fish, such as tilapia or halibut, if salmon isn’t your thing. For those who love a smokier flavor, try adding smoked paprika to the spice mix for the salmon.

Reader Questions & Solutions

  1. What can I do if I don’t have a grill?
    You can easily bake the salmon in the oven at 400°F for about 12-15 minutes instead of grilling.

  2. How do I know when the salmon is cooked?
    The salmon should be opaque and flake easily with a fork. You can also use a meat thermometer; it should read 145°F in the thickest part of the fillet.

  3. Can I freeze the salmon after cooking it?
    Yes, you can freeze the cooked salmon for up to 2 months. Just make sure to cool it completely and w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and foil.

  4. What can I substitute for mango if it’s out of season?
    Fresh peaches or diced apples can be delightful alternatives in the salsa.
